Manveer Boy
Origin(s)
Pronunciationmahn-VEER / mənˈvɪrPunjabi; Sanskrit
Meaning
brave man (Punjabi); one who is brave (Sanskrit)
Historical & Cultural Background
In Punjabi culture, Manveer is often associated with valor and strength, reflecting the importance of bravery in Sikh and Punjabi traditions. The Sanskrit origin emphasizes courage, aligning with the broader Indian cultural values of heroism and resilience.

U.S. Historical Usage
The name Manveer was first seen in the United States in 1995. Manveer has ranked as high as #1369 nationally, which occurred in 2006, and has been most popular in California. In the past 5 years the name Manveer has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.
